Canterbury haven't been too far from a headline since the arrival of Lachlan Galvin and coach Cameron Ciraldo has made the big call to drop Toby Sexton for this game and seemingly the remainder of the season, with the 20-year-old to start at halfback. Signing Galvin mid-season when the team was flying high at the top of the table was always a huge gamble and from the outside looking in, you can't help but feel the playing group feels disrupted. However, Ciraldo has proven himself as an outstanding young coach and he will no doubt have the support of the playing group going forward.

I think the most likely outcome for this game is the Bulldogs winning a tight one on the back of their well-renowned defence. The Dragons have made a habit of losing close games all season - they've suffered defeats five times by margins of six points or less - including by one point on three occasions, while they were upstaged by seven points last week against the Roosters. Canterbury meanwhile scored two tries in the 36th and 40th minutes last week against the Cowboys and that was ultimately enough to prevail 12-8, with not a single point scored in the second half. Matt Burton has been enjoying a standout season and I think he'll lift with a new partner in the halves.

Head To Head


Canterbury have won the last four meetings between the teams, including a 28-20 triumph in Round 1 earlier this season in which they scored 24 of their points between the 31st and 52nd minute.

Canterbury Bulldogs Form Analysis


There's been quite a bit of negativity surrounding the Bulldogs over the last month, but at the end of the day, they've only lost to the Broncos, Panthers and Dolphins this season and remain just two points adrift of Canberra at the top of the table.

Canterbury responded strongly to suffering back-to-back defeats for the first time this season, earning a hard-fought 12-8 victory over the Cowboys that was built on the back of some brick-wall defence and a pair of tries to Jacob Preston and debutant winger Jethro Rinakama just before half-time.

Clearly the Dogs have been stagnating in attack lately, scoring just one try against Penrith, suffering an almighty collapse in the final 20 minutes against Brisbane and only managing two tries against the worst defence in the competition last week vs North Queensland.

Canterbury Bulldogs Team News


It was always going to happen, so I think it's a good move from Ciraldo to bite the bullet and name Galvin to replace Sexton at halfback - if they get the win here, the headlines will stop and everyone will begin to move on.

Stephen Crichton and Kurt Mann return from Origin after missing last week, with Crichton replacing the injured Bronson Xerri in the centres, meaning Rinakama retains his spot on the wing after an impressive debut.

Daniel Suluka-Fifita (concussion) and Sitili Tupouniua (hamstring) are a chance of forcing their way into the starting side after being names in the reseves.

St George Illawarra Dragons Form Analysis


It's looking like a season of what could have been for the Dragons as they head into this showdown in 11th spot on the ladder.

Two wins outside of the top eight, there's still time for the Dragons to make a late charge towards the finals, but losing five games by six points or less could define their season.

Shane Flanagan's side were once more left to rue missed opportunities as they went down by seven points against the Roosters at home last week, with a 78th minute try to Victor Radley sealing the Dragons' fate.

A poor away record and lack of killer punch/leadership in the halves is a huge issue for the Dragons and something they're unlikely to overcome for the remainder of 2025.

St George Illawarra Dragons Team News


Flanagan has opted to name the same 17 players that went down against the Chooks, with Mat Feagai a chance of making his return from a long-term ankle injury after being named in the reserves.
